Installing Bottom Mounting Screws

1.Locate two bottom mounting holes. These holes are near bot- tom on back panel of heater (see Figure 12).

2.Mark screw locations on wall.

3.Remove heater from mounting bracket.

4.If installing bottom mounting screws into hollow or solid wall, install wall anchors. Follow steps 1 through 4 under Attaching To Wall Anchor Method, page 9.

If installing bottom mounting screw into wall stud, drill holes at marked locations using 9/64" drill bit.

5.Replace heater onto mounting bracket.

6.Place spacers between bottom mounting holes and wall anchor or drilled hole.

7.Hold spacer in place with one hand. With other hand, insert mounting screw through bottom mounting hole and spacer. Place tip of screw in opening of wall anchor or drilled hole.

8.Tighten both screws until heater is firmly secured to wall. Do not over tighten.

Note: Do not replace front panel at this time. Replace front panel after making gas connections and checking for leaks (see pages 11 and 12).

MOUNTING HEATER TO FLOOR

Mounting Base Feet to Heater

1.Lay heater cabinet on its back on a table with the heater bot- tom overhanging the table edge.

2.Align holes in base foot with mounting holes on bottom of cabinet (see Figure 13).

3.Secure base foot to heater using sheet metal screws.

4.Repeat for other side.

Mounting Base Feet to Floor (Where required by local code)

1.Remove front cover (see Removing Front Panel of Heater, page 8).

2.Position heater with base feet in desired location. Mark holes for drilling. Remove heater with base.

3.For carpeted floors, make a small cut with a sharp knife at marked locations prior to drilling. If mounting base to a wood floor, drill 1/8 inch diameter hole, 3/4 inch deep. (Do not use anchors in wood floors).

If mounting base to a concrete floor, drill with 1/4 inch diam- eter concrete drill bit, 13/8 inches into floor. Insert anchors com- pletely into holes.

4.Reposition heater with base feet over holes. Secure base to floor with wood screws. See Figure 13.
